Output 90608e7673885ad09dc8e1de85fe5af68eb13869e88e44c214acb016d04a2214:53

value
257817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2125c716ce2cf0103048d681b529782966dbf721 OP_EQUAL
address
34iHUiNopZBPxbFQB1adzpP9ofXxxseBoK
transaction
90608e7673885ad09dc8e1de85fe5af68eb13869e88e44c214acb016d04a2214
spent
true